OTOH, the charger should be phase factor corrected, which implies a similarly sized inductor for a boost converter. If the output current doesn't need to be constant, but abs(sin(t)) is sufficient, the PFC could be integrated with the flyback stage.
Bumping up the switching frequency from 100kHz to 1MHz, replacing the switch with a SiC device and selecting a multiphase flyback topology might in fact work with a low-loss ferrite "transformer" on, say, 3C95.
